IVF/ICSI

In Panama we have an IVF laboratory with state of the art technology as well as a multidiscipline staff, which are trained with the latest technologies available in Reproductive Medicine.  The original technique dominated by IVF and with this technique the fertilization of the oocyte by the sperm is produce in an artificial method that is the laboratory, but the process of fertilization is total natural as there is on average about 200,000.00 sperm around one oocyte, the one that penetrates naturally and forms an embryo will be transferred to the uterine cavity via different types of catheters.

When sperm quality is poor, or there is an indication from prior testing that the sperm will be poor quality and will not be able to fertilize the oocyte on its own, we proceed with a technique called Intra Cytoplasmic Sperm Injection known as ICSI.  This technique is a direct injection of a single sperm into each egg.  The fertilization rate per egg using ICSI is about 70% despite the sperm being terrible, the fertilization rate per infertile couple is over 99% if the wife has adequate eggs, and the pregnancy rate per treatment cycle is over 50%. This is not significantly different from regular IVF with normal sperm. This technique is very cost-effective, and will give you the same high chance for getting pregnant as any couple with normal sperm.

IVF (in vitro fertilization) is the most common form of ART (Assisted Reproductive Technology). If the fallopian tubes are damaged or the sperm is poor, it is obviously the only acceptable treatment. It is also usually the most effective treatment for most other types of infertility as well.  This procedure achieves remarkable pregnancies even in women with hopelessly damaged fallopian tubes, seemingly sterile husbands, and even “unexplained” infertility. Oocyte Bank

At Fertility Treatment in Panama, we offer the option to cryopreserve ooyctes, to any woman that would like to prolong her ovarian oocyte reserve due to personal or professional reasons.  Candidates for this option are women under 35 years of age, but women older than 35 years of age we recommend not prolonging procreation and also speaking to your doctor and your possibilities of pregnancy based on your age and ovarian reserve.

In other cases, an illness or the treatment to cure the illness can affect future fertility and there is the possibility to cryopreserve oocytes, until you are ready to proceed with motherhood.

In cases for women that cannot achieve pregnancy using their own oocytes, due to poor ovarian reserve or poor egg quality, we do offer oocyte donation which gives challenged infertile patients the possibility to become parents.  The donation is anonymous. In the procedure the couple (recipient) is synchronized to receive the donated oocyte (donors) that will be fertilized with the spouse’s sperm and will make the embryos unique.  The embryo is then transferred to the recipient uterus where implantation and gestation will result in pregnancy.

Male Infertility

Approximately 15% of couples attempting their first pregnancy meet with failure. Most authorities define these patients as primarily infertile if they have been unable to achieve a pregnancy after one year of unprotected intercourse. Conception normally is achieved within twelve months in 80-85% of couples who use no contraceptive measures, and persons presenting after this time should therefore be regarded as possibly infertile and should be evaluated. Data available over the past twenty years reveal that in approximately 30% of cases pathology is found in the man alone, and in another 20% both the man and woman are abnormal. Therefore, the male factor is at least partly responsible in about 50% of infertile couples.

Important issues related to the evaluation of the male factor include the most appropriate time for the male evaluation, the most efficient format for a comprehensive male exam, and definition of rationale and effective medical and surgical regimens in the treatment of these disorders. It is extremely important in the evaluation of infertility to consider the couple as a unit in evaluation and treatment and to proceed in a parallel investigative manner until a problem is uncovered. It has been shown that the longer a couple remains subfertile, the worse their chance for an effective cure. Many couples experience significant apprehension and anxiety after only a few months of failure to conceive. Unduly prolonged unprotected intercourse should not be advocated before a workup of the man is instituted. Initial screening of the man should be considered whenever the patient presents with the chief complaint of infertility. This initial evaluation should be rapid, non-invasive and cost effective. Of interest is the fact that pregnancy rates of up to 50% have been reported when only the woman has been investigated and treated even when the man was found to have moderately severe abnormalities of semen quality.

Genetics

In Fertility Treatment in Panama by Panama Fertility we have a Genetics laboratory (BIOGEN) which has the most advanced technology to study genetic embryo, fetus and adult, we know that genetic alterations are a major cause of sterility and infertility and may be responsible for the defects observed in the newborn.
 
Among these, the chromosomal alterations that are responsible for 2.5 % of infant mortality; In addition, these alterations are present in more than 50% of miscarriages in the first trimester. Chromosomal analysis has provided a basic knowledge of the genetic changes responsible for the chromosome alterations and in the case of cancer, the processes that occur during the malignant transformation of tumor cells.

PRE-REQUISITE TESTING LIST

 
Step I. Uterine Cavity Evaluation (must be completed within 6 months of IVFcycle)
 
Saline Sonogram - Make an appointment with your OB/GYN on the first day of your next period to schedule.  This appointment needs to be scheduled on cycle day 7 thru 10.
 
Step II . Required Infectious Disease Screening and Genetic Testing for Female & Male (test valid for one year)
 
Female Blood Testing 
  • FSH, LH, Estradial (Cycle Day 2 or 3)
  • HTLV I/II
  • RPR
  • HIV
  • Hepatitis B surface antigen
  • Hepatitis C antibody
  • RH Blood Type
  • CBC
  • Glucose (Fasting)
  • TSH/Prolactin/Rubella/Varicella
  • Toxoplasmosis
  • German Measles Test (rubella Igg)
  • Karyotype
  • Cystic Fibrosis
Male Blood Typing      
  • HIV
  • HTLV I/II
  • RPR
  • Hepatitis B surface antigen
  • Hepatitis C antibody
  • RH Blood Type
  • Karyotype
  • Cystic Fibrosis
* Sperm DNA Fragmentation test if over 45 yrs. old
 
Step III.  Required IVF Semen Analysis (good for one year) Contact your OB/GYN and ask for a referral to an IVF clinic in your area to schedule an appointment for a semen analysis for your spouse. This test can also be performed in Panama  at our IVF clinic which cost
$30, if it makes the process easier, but all the infectious disease screening must be completed and copies of test results must be available.  Once ALL test have been completed we can then give a proper  protocol for your IVF cycle. A calendar will be created, given you exact dates for your IVF treatment and the length of time you will need to be in Panama.

New Technology in Panama Fertility

06-02-2012
 
The incubator is one of the most important equipments in assisted reproduction laboratories because here is where embryos are developed at different evolutionary stages. Physiologically the female reproductive tract has a low tension of oxygen (5-7%), with levels of certain pH, reason for which have been set up incubators that maintain the same characteristics in the culture media to ensure an embryonic development similar to the physiological environment.
 
Today in Panama Fertility Center, we count with one known as Triple Gas incubator of last generation. It has a mixture of gases (5% or2, 6% CO2,and 84% N2), addition it has small individual compartments, this will allow embryonic growth in an isolated and controlled manner, avoiding fluctuations in temperature and gases that occurred with the ancient incubators. 
                                                                                   
We also acquired a Laminar Flow Chamber with plate illumination of last generation, it is a workstation where the embryologist performs the manipulation of gametes pre-trial procedures, in a controlled microenvironment of temperature, gases (CO2) and free of microorganisms that may alter the results of assisted reproduction procedures.
 
From the implementation of these equipments, we have seen an increase in our evolutionary pregnancy rates, up to 80% in women under 35 years (10/12) and an increase of 10% in those over 35 years of women.
